So this thread on chickens got me thinking hum.. wonder where having chickens in LAKE COUNTY **IS** possible.
https://www.indianagunowners.com/forums/survival_and_disaster_preparedness/280076-chickens.html
Looking at griffith's codes it's a
Sec. 10-6. - Farm animals.
(a)
No person shall own, possess or have custody on his premises in a residential area any animal classified as a farm animal, such as, but not limited to, horses, pigs, goats, chickens, etc.
(b)a
No person shall keep or permit to be kept in a residential area any farm animal as a pet.
(c)
This section shall not be construed as to prevent the operation of any farm or agricultural business properly operating within the zoning laws of the town.
(Ord. No. 94-21, 6-14-94)
Municode;
Anyone know where in LAKE it's ok? I would imagine everything NORTH of US-30 is probably a as well. Well maybe some sections of Gary that are still zoned "farms".
